Re: Sean Mc
 
Had a shocker tonight. This make-shift striker plan isn't working. No Sean's fault. He just hasn't got a strikers mentality. Neither he or Pell were close enough or in the right areas to feed off Colby. The rookie strikers we have don't get enough game time to develop. Playing players out of position is a last gasp approach when you have absolutely no alternative.......It's like having size 10 feet in size 9 shoes. The ball just wasn't sticking up front and came back time and time again straight through midfield putting pressure on defence.

Apart from the fifteen minute spell after half time when we kept the ball and played in the final third we never looked like we were in control of the game. The windy conditions didn't help but it was the same for both teams and Wimbledon adapted better to the conditions. They were better in the first half and exploited the wide open spaces around our back 3. In the second half they pressed us hard without the ball, had pace with it, and when all else failed they simply played percentages and kicked the ball high, long and forward into dangerous areas. They won't beat the better teams like that but we just couldn't cope with it.
